Tratos is the first to achieve BASEC approval for medium voltage
Tratos is the first and only cable manufacturer in Europe to achieve BASEC approval for medium voltage cables to BS 7870-4.10, a cable type specifically intended for a wide range of cable applications between 6.35 and 33kV for power distribution.
